Over the last few months, Holloway Iliffe & Mitchell has seen a significant increase in property and asset management appointments across a wide geography as its bespoke services are more sought after by investors, landlords and tenants.

The most appointments include:

• Mixed use premises, Wokingham – 7,788 sq ft ground floor restaurant and upper floor development to residential at Baileys House for Malins Group
• Office park, Liphook – rent collection and service charge on three newly constructed and leased office and light industrial units at Ordnance Busines Park totalling 22,000 sq ft for East Hampshire District Council
• Business Park, Petersfield – following the successful sale, now managing 5,000 sq ft at 3 Viceory Court fo a private investor
• Business Park, Petersfield – 3,000 sq ft industrial premises on Bedford road let on behalf of a private SIPP provider.
• Mixed use premises, Portsmouth – ground floor shop and first floor dance hall at 164/168 Fratton Road let on two separate leases
• Light industrial development, Lee-on-the-Solent – Phase II Daedalus Park a further 40 modern light industrial / business units, totalling 50,000 sq ft
